About MPA CREAM

MPA CREAM is a type of medicine known as a corticosteroid. It is specifically designed to address various inflammatory skin conditions like atopic dermatitis and allergic skin conditions. The main purpose of MPA CREAM is to bring relief from symptoms such as redness, swelling, and pain in the affected skin area.

It is crucial to note that MPA CREAM is formulated for external use exclusively and should be used in accordance with your doctor's instructions. Before application, it is essential to cleanse and dry the affected area thoroughly. When applying the cream, ensure a thin layer is spread evenly across the impacted skin. Avoid using MPA CREAM on open wounds or damaged skin as this may cause adverse effects.

Consistency in using MPA CREAM is key to reaping its full benefits. It is important to steer clear of contact with your eyes, nose, or mouth to prevent any unwanted reactions. In case of accidental contact, promptly rinse off the cream with an ample amount of water. Unless otherwise advised by a healthcare provider, refrain from covering the treated area with tight dressings like bandages.

Like most medications, MPA CREAM may lead to some common side effects such as burning, irritation, itching, and redness at the application site. These side effects are typically temporary and tend to resolve over time. However, in case they persist or worsen, it is advisable to inform your doctor promptly. Individuals who are pregnant or breastfeeding should engage in discussion with their healthcare providers regarding the safety considerations of using MPA CREAM.

How to use the MPA CREAM

To use MPA CREAM, make sure to follow these simple steps for effective application. Firstly, remember that this cream is meant for external use only. To begin, carefully read the directions on the label before using to ensure proper application. Clean and dry the affected area of your skin before applying the cream. Gently apply a thin layer of the cream to the affected area and avoid getting it in your eyes, nose, or mouth. After applying the cream, remember to wash your hands thoroughly, unless your hands are the affected area. It's important to use the cream in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or for the best results. Remember, consistency is key when using MPA CREAM to help alleviate your skin concerns effectively.

Side effects of MPA CREAM

When using MPA CREAM, some users may experience side effects such as application site reactions like burning, irritation, itching, and redness. Furthermore, the cream can also lead to thinning of the skin, which might increase the risk of infection. Additionally, there is a possibility of reduced bone density, weight gain, and mood changes while using this cream. If you notice any upset stomach or behavioral changes, it is essential to consult your doctor. Most of these side effects are temporary and should improve as your body gets used to the cream, but if they persist or concern you, seek medical advice promptly.
